Global konforme cXML-Rechnungsstellung – Vereinigtes Königreich

Revised: 31 August 2017

Allgemeine Voraussetzungen für die Compliance

  1. Die Compliance für das jeweilige Land muss in Coupa aktiviert sein.
  2. Für die Coupa-Instanz muss eine Rechnungslegung für das entsprechende Land konfiguriert sein.
  3. Wichtiger Schritt: Der Lieferant muss im Coupa Supplier Portal (CSP) verknüpft werden und eine Zahlungsempfängeradresse im CSP erstellen.
  4. Der Lieferant muss im cXML-Code auf diese Zahlungsempfängeradresse verweisen, indem er auf den Zahlungsempfängercode und den Zahlungsempfängernamen oder die genaue Adresse wie unten angegeben verweist.

Weitere Informationen finden Sie unter Compliance as a Service.Compliance as a Service">

cXML-Beispiel für Zahlungsempfängeradresse

Die folgenden Felder sind für Rechnungen an die Zahlungsempfängeradresse erforderlich:

  • Name des primären Kontakts des Lieferanten
  • Zahlungsempfängeradresse des Lieferanten - Diese Adresse muss aus dem CSP erstellt werden.
Hinweis

 

  • addressID wird dem Feld "remit_to_code" für Zahlungsempfängeradressen aus dem CSP zugeordnet.
    • Überschreibt alle Adressinformationen innerhalb des Elements PostalAddress.
  • IdReference verwendet zwei Elemente, die für konforme Rechnungen erforderlich sind:
    • taxPrefix: USt.-Code des Lieferanten (normalerweise identisch mit dem Steuerland-Code).
    • taxNumber: USt-ID-Nummer des Lieferanten.
<InvoicePartner>
	 <Contact role="remitTo" addressID="badbeef">
			 <Name xml:lang="en">Vernon Dursely</Name>
			 <PostalAddress name="default">
					 <Street>4 Privet Drive</Street>
					 <City>Little Whinging</City>
					 <State>Surrey</State>
					 <PostalCode>CR3</PostalCode>
					 <Country
							 isoCountryCode="GB">82</Country>
			 </PostalAddress>
	 </Contact>
	 <IdReference domain="taxPrefix" identifier="GB" />
	 <IdReference domain="taxNumber" identifier="2f3207092f5e" />
</InvoicePartner>

cXML-Beispiel für Rechnungsempfängeradresse

Die folgenden Felder sind für Rechnungen mit Rechnungsempfängeradresse erforderlich:

  • Name des primären Kontakts des Kunden
  • Rechnungsempfängeradresse des Kunden
Hinweis
  • addressID: Numerische ID der Adresse in Coupa.
  • Beim Suchvorgang wird zuerst anhand von addressID gesucht, falls angegeben; wenn für die ID keine Übereinstimmung gefunden wird, wird nach einer genauen Übereinstimmung auf der Basis des Inhalts des Elements PostalAddress gesucht.
<InvoicePartner>
	 <Contact role="billTo" addressID="1">
			 <Name xml:lang="en">Minh Tran</Name>
			 <PostalAddress name="default">
					 <DeliverTo>Minh Tran</DeliverTo>
					 <Street>street</Street>
					 <Street>Suite 300</Street>
					 <City>SS</City>
					 <State>CA</State>
					 <PostalCode>77842</PostalCode>
					 <Country
							 isoCountryCode="US">United States</Country>
			 </PostalAddress>
			 <Email name="default">minh@coupa.com</Email>
			 <Phone name="work">
					 <TelephoneNumber>
							 <CountryCode
									 isoCountryCode="US">1</CountryCode>
							 <AreaOrCityCode>745</AreaOrCityCode>
							 <Number>4466</Number>
					 </TelephoneNumber>
			 </Phone>
	 </Contact>
</InvoicePartner>

Wichtige Felder für die Lieferadresse bei der cXML-Rechnungsstellung

Dies sind optionale Felder für die konforme cXML-Rechnungsstellung.

Wichtige Felder auf Kopfebene bei der cXML-Rechnungsstellung

Stellen Sie sicher, dass die folgenden Tags in von Lieferanten generierten cXML-Rechnungen enthalten sind:

Feldname

Status

Rechnungsnummer/Gutschriftnummer Obligatorisch
Rechnungsdatum/Gutschriftdatum Obligatorisch
Vertragsnummer Optional
Bestellungsnummer Optional
Währung Obligatorisch
Nummer der Lieferung Optional
Lieferdatum (Steuerzeitpunkt) Obligatorisch. Standardmäßig Rechnungsdatum
Zahlungsbedingung Obligatorisch. Standardmäßig gelten die für den Lieferanten eingerichteten Zahlungsbedingungen.
Referenz-Rechnungsnummer Obligatorisch für Gutschrift, gilt nicht für Rechnung
Referenz-Rechnungsdatum Obligatorisch für Gutschrift, gilt nicht für Rechnung
Grund für Gutschrift Obligatorisch für Gutschrift
Hinweise vom Lieferant Optional (Freitextbereich)

Wichtige Felder auf Positionsebene bei der cXML-Rechnungsstellung

Feldname

Status

Zeilennummer

Optional

Position

Optional

Warenbezeichnung

Obligatorisch

Menge

Obligatorisch

Preis pro Einheit

Obligatorisch

Nettobetrag der Position (Menge * Preis pro Einheit)

Berechnet

Skonto/Rabatt

Optional

Auf jeweilige Position angewendete/r Umsatzwertsteuersatz/-sätze

Prozentsatz oder „Befreit“

USt.-Betrag für entsprechende Position

Obligatorisch

Wichtige Felder für Betrag auf Zusammenfassungsebene bei der cXML-Rechnungsstellung

Feldname

Status

Versteuerbarer Betrag gesamt (ohne USt.)

Obligatorisch

Zahlbarer Betrag Steuern/USt. gesamt

Obligatorisch. Der Standardwert ist 0.

Gesamtbetrag (inkl. Steuern/USt.)

Obligatorisch

Vollständiges Beispiel für eine cXML-Rechnung mit Bestellbezug, die Konformität für das Vereinigte Königreich hat


<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E cXML SYSTEM "http://xml.cXML.org/schemas/cXML/1.2.020/InvoiceDetail.dtd">
<cXML version="1.0" payloadID="1240598937@SUBDOMAIN.coupahost.com" timestamp="2015-10-15T01:24:51-07:00">
<Header>
<From>
<Credential domain="DUNS">
<Identity>12345</Identity>
</Credential>
</From>
<To>
<Credential domain="DUNS">
<Identity>12345</Identity>
</Credential>
</To>
<Sender>
<Credential domain="DUNS">
<Identity>12345</Identity>
<SharedSecret>compliance</SharedSecret>
</Credential>
<UserAgent>Your Very Own Agent 1.23</UserAgent>
</Sender>
</Header>
<Request deploymentMode="production">
<InvoiceDetailRequest>
			<InvoiceDetailRequestHeader invoiceID="8957494" purpose="standard" operation="new" invoiceDate="2015-10-15T11:45:51-07:00">
				<InvoiceDetailHeaderIndicator/>
				<InvoiceDetailLineIndicator
						isAccountingInLine="yes"/>		 
				<InvoicePartner>
										<Contact role="remitTo" addressID="100">
												<Name xml:lang="en">Greenham1</Name>
										</Contact>
</InvoicePartner>
				<PaymentTerm payInNumberOfDays="30">
				</PaymentTerm>
			</InvoiceDetailRequestHeader>
			<InvoiceDetailOrder>
				<InvoiceDetailOrderInfo>
		<OrderReference>
				<DocumentReference payloadID="286"/>
		</OrderReference>
				</InvoiceDetailOrderInfo>
				<!-- First invoice quantity line. -->
				<InvoiceDetailItem invoiceLineNumber="1" quantity="10">
					<UnitOfMeasure>EA</UnitOfMeasure>
					<UnitPrice>
						<Money currency="GBP">30.05</Money>
					</UnitPrice>
					 
					<InvoiceDetailItemReference lineNumber="1">
						<Description xml:lang="en">	 Coverall Fras Navy 370515 New White Bbes/Zh Heatseal Logos
						</Description>
					</InvoiceDetailItemReference>
						<SubtotalAmount>
						<Money currency="GBP">300.50</Money>
					</SubtotalAmount>
				</InvoiceDetailItem>
			</InvoiceDetailOrder>
			<InvoiceDetailSummary>
					<SubtotalAmount>
					<Money currency="GBP">300.50</Money>
				</SubtotalAmount>
				<Tax>
	 <Money currency="GBP" alternateAmount="10" alternateCurrency="EUR">8</Money>
					<Description xml:lang="en">total tax</Description>
					<TaxDetail purpose="tax" category="Standard Rate"
											 percentageRate="21"
											 taxPointDate="2015-10-15T11:45:51-07:00">
						<TaxableAmount>
							<Money currency="GBP">300.50</Money>
						</TaxableAmount>
						<TaxAmount>
							<Money currency="GBP">46</Money>
						</TaxAmount>
						<TaxLocation xml:lang="en">P5</TaxLocation>
					</TaxDetail>
				</Tax>
				<NetAmount>
					<Money currency="GBP"></Money>
				</NetAmount>
			</InvoiceDetailSummary>
		</InvoiceDetailRequest>
	</Request>
</cXML>

Parts or all of this page might have been machine-translated. We apologize for any inaccuracies.